The Sony UWP-D26 Wireless Microphone Kit provides top-level audio sound quality and unparalleled ease of use for the professional filmmaker and audio recordist.

Reliable and robust RF transmission paired with unique digital processing enables the UWP-D26 to achieve fantastic results in any situation.

The kit includes the TX-B40 bodypack transmitter, UTX-P40 XLR plug-on transmitter and URX-P40 receiver, plus accessories.

 

 

URX-P40 portable receiver

Oscillator Type

Crystal-controlled PLL synthesizer

Reception Type

True diversity method

Antenna Type

1/4 λ wavelength wire antenna (angle-adjustable)

Carrier Frequencies

14UC : 470.125 MHz to 541.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 14 to 25)
25UC : 536.125 MHz to 607.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 25 to 36)
42LA : 638.125 MHz to 697.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 42 to 51)
90UC : 941.625 MHz to 951.875 MHz, 953.000 MHz to 956.125 MHz, and 956.625 MHz to 959.625 MHz
21CE : 470.025 MHz to 542.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 21 to 29)
33CE : 566.025 MHz to 630.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 33 to 40)
42CE : 638.025 MHz to 694.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 42 to 48)
38CN : 710.025 MHz to 782.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 38 to 46)
E : 794.125 MHz to 805.875 MHz
BJ : 806.125 MHz to 809.750 MHz
KR : 925.125 MHz to 937.500 MHz

Frequency Response

23 Hz to 18 kHz (typical) (UC, U, CE, LA, CN, E, KR models)
40 Hz to 15 kHz (typical) (J model)

Signal-to-Noise Ratio

60 dB (1 kHz sine wave, 5 kHz modulation)

Distortion (T.H.D)

0.9% or less (1 kHz sine wave, 5 kHz modulation)

Audio Delay

Approx. 0.35 ms (analog output)
Approx. 0.24 ms (digital output)

Audio Output Connector

3.5mm diameter 3-pole locking mini jack, , external connection

Audio Output Level

–60 dBV (3.5 mm diameter 3-pole locking mini jack, analog output, 0 dB audio output level)
–20 dBFS (external connection, digital output, 0 dB audio output level)
–50 dBFS (external connection, analog output, 0 dB audio output level)

Analog Audio Output Adjustment Range

-12dB – +12dB (3dB step)

Headphone Output Connector

3.5 mm diameter mini jack
Headphone Output Level
Max. 10mW (16-ohm)
Tone Signal Frequency
In UWP-D compander mode: 32.382 kHz
In UWP compander mode: 32 kHz
In WL800 compander mode: 32.768 kHz
Display
OLED
Power Requirements
DC 3.0 V (two LR6/AA size alkaline batteries)
DC 5.0 V (supplied from USB Type-C connector)
Battery Life*
Approx. six hours
*Battery life has been measured with two Sony LR6/AA size alkaline batteries at 25 °C (77 °F) DISPLAY MODE set to AUTO OFF.
Operating Temperature
0 °C to 50 °C (32 °F to 122 °F)
Storage/Transport Temperature
–20 °C to +55 °C (–4 °F to +131 °F)
Dimensions
63 x 70 x 31 mm (2 1/2 x 2 7/8 x 1 1/4 in.) (W / H / D) (excluding antenna)
Mass
Approx. 131 g (4.6 oz) (excluding batteries)

UTX-B40 bodypack transmitter

Oscillator Type
Crystal-controlled PLL synthesizer
Antenna Type
1/4 λ wave length wire antenna
Carrier Frequencies
14UC : 470.125 MHz to 541.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 14 to 25)
25UC : 536.125 MHz to 607.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 25 to 36)
42LA : 638.125 MHz to 697.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 42 to 51)
90UC : 941.625 MHz to 951.875 MHz, 953.000 MHz to 956.125 MHz, and 956.625 MHz to 959.625 MHz
21CE : 470.025 MHz to 542.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 21 to 29)
33CE : 566.025 MHz to 630.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 33 to 40)
42CE : 638.025 MHz to 694.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 42 to 48)
38CN : 710.025 MHz to 782.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 38 to 46)
E : 794.125 MHz to 805.875 MHz
BJ: 806.125 MHz to 809.750 MHz
KR : 925.125 MHz to 937.500 MHz
RF Output Power
30 mW/5 mW selectable (UC, U, CE, LA, CN models)
10 mW/2 mW selectable (J, E, KR models)
Capsule Type
Elect retcondenser
Directivity
Omni-directional
Input Connector
3.5 mm diameter 3-pole locking mini jack
Reference Audio Input Level
–60 dBV (MIC input, GAIN MODE set to NORMAL, 0 dB attenuation)
+4 dBu (LINE input )
Audio Attenuator Adjustment Range
0 dB to 27 dB (3 dB steps)
Frequency Response
23 Hz to 18 kHz (Typical) (UC, U, CE, LA, CN, E, KR models)
40 Hz to 15 kHz (Typical) (J model)
Signal-to-Noise Ratio
60 dB (–60 dBV, 1 kHz input)
102 dB (GAIN MODE set to AUTO GAIN, max.)
96 dB (GAIN MODE set to NORMAL, max.)
Distortion
0.9% or less (–60 dBV, 1 kHz input)
Audio Delay
Approx. 0.35 ms
Tone Signal Frequency
In UWP-D compander mode: 32.382 kHz
In UWP compander mode: 32 kHz
In WL800 compander mode: 32.768 kHz
Display
OLED
Power Requirements
DC 3.0 V (two LR6/AA size alkaline batteries)
DC 5.0 V (supplied from USB Type-C connector)
Battery life*
Approx. 8 hours with output power of 30 mW (UC, U, CE, LA, CN models)
Approx. 10 hours with output power of 10 mW (J, E, KR models)* Battery life has been measured with two Sony LR6/AA size alkaline batteries at 25 °C (77 °F).
Operating Temperature
0 °C to 50 °C (32 °F to 122 °F)
Storage/Transport Temperature
-20 °C to +55 °C (–4 °F to +131 °F)
Dimensions
63 x 73 x 19 mm (2 1/2 x 2 7/8 x 3/4 in.) (W / H / D) (excluding antenna)
Mass
Approx. 83 g (2.9 oz) (excluding batteries)

UTX-P40 XLR plug-on transmitter

Oscillator Type
Crystal-controlled PLL synthesizer
Carrier Frequencies
14UC : 470.125 MHz to 541.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 14 to 25)
25UC : 536.125 MHz to 607.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 25 to 36)
42LA : 638.125 MHz to 697.875 MHz (UHF-TV channels 42 to 51)
90UC : 941.625 MHz to 951.875 MHz, 953.000 MHz to 956.125 MHz, and 956.625 MHz to 959.625 MHz
21CE : 470.025 MHz to 542.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 21 to 29)
33CE : 566.025 MHz to 630.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 33 to 40)
42CE : 638.025 MHz to 694.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 42 to 48)
38CN : 710.025 MHz to 782.000 MHz (UHF-TV channels 38 to 46)
E : 794.125 MHz to 805.875 MHz
BJ : 806.125 MHz to 809.750 MHz
KR : 925.125 MHz to 937.500 MHz
RF Output Power
40 mW/5 mW selectable (UC, U, LA models)
30 mW/5 mW selectable (CE, CN models)
10 mW/2 mW selectable (J, E, KR models)
Input Connector
XLR-3-11C type (female)
Reference Audio Input Level
–60 dBV (MIC input, GAIN MODE set to NORMAL, 0 dB attenuation)
Audio Attenuator Adjustment Range
0 dB to 48 dB (3 dB steps)
Frequency Response
23 Hz to 18 kHz (Typical) (UC, U, CE, LA, CN, E, KR models)
40 Hz to 15 kHz (Typical) (J model)
Signal-to-Noise Ratio
60 dB (–60 dBV, 1 kHz input)
102 dB (GAIN MODE set to AUTO GAIN, max.)
96 dB (GAIN MODE set to NORMAL, max.)
Distortion
0.9% or less (–60 dBV, 1 kHz input)
Audio Delay
Approx. 0.35 ms
Tone Signal Frequency
In UWP-D compander mode: 32.382 kHz
In UWP compander mode: 32 kHz
In WL800 compander mode: 32.768 kHz
Display
OLED
Power Requirements
DC 3.0 V (two LR6/AA size alkaline batteries)
DC 5.0 V (supplied from USB Type-C connector)
Battery Life*
During +48V OFF:
Approx. 7 hours with output power of 40 mW (UC, U, LA models)
Approx. 8 hours with output power of 30 mW (CE, CN models)
Approx. 10 hours with output power of 10 mW (J, E, KR models)During +48V ON and ECM-673 connection:
Approx. 6 hours with output power of 40 mW (UC, U, LA models)
Approx. 6 hours with output power of 30 mW (CE, CN models)
Approx. 7 hours with output power of 10 mW (J, E, KR models)* Battery life has been measured with two Sony L R6/AA size alkaline batteries at 25 °C (77 °F).
Operating Temperature
0 °C t o 50 °C (32 °F to 122 °F)
Storage/Transport Temperature
–20 °C to +55 °C (–4 °F to +131 °F)
Dimensions
38 x 98 x 38 mm (1 1/2 x 3 7/8 x 1 1/2 in.) (W / H / D) (including the audio input connector)
Mass
Approx. 139 g (4.9 oz) (excluding batteries)
